[发明专利]一种通信应用的启动方法及移动终端有效
申请号: | 201710377895.4 | 申请日: | 2017-05-25 |
公开(公告)号: | CN107122217B | 公开(公告)日: | 2019-08-20 |
发明(设计)人: | 毛源泽 | 申请(专利权)人: | 维沃移动通信有限公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445;G06F9/54 |
代理公司: | 北京银龙知识产权代理有限公司 11243 | 代理人: | 许静;黄灿 |
地址: | 523860 广东省*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 通信 应用 启动 方法 移动 终端 | ||
本发明提供一种通信应用的启动方法及移动终端,启动通信应用的进程;从联系人应用中获取与每个通信会话的通信号码对应的联系人信息;将获取的多个联系人信息缓存至所述通信应用中;在缓存至所述通信应用中的多个联系人信息中,查询与每个通信会话的通信号码对应的联系人信息;在每个通信会话中显示所述对应的联系人信息。这样,移动终端在启动通信应用的进程时,可以将通信应用中需要查询的信息批量在联系人应用中进行查询,从而将在联系人应用中批量查询到的多个联系人信息直接反转缓存至通信应用中,方便通信应用直接查询,减少在不同应用程序间的切换,减轻移动终端后台工作的负担,以避免因通信应用的进程启动引起的响应慢、卡顿及白屏问题。
技术领域
本发明涉及通信领域,尤其涉及一种通信应用的启动方法及移动终端。
背景技术
随着科技的发展进步,通信技术得到了飞速发展和长足的进步,而随着通信技术的提高,智能电子产品的普及提高到了一个前所未有的高度,越来越多的智能终端或移动终端成为人们生活中不可或缺的一部分,如智能手机、智能电视和电脑等。
在移动终端普及的同时,用户对移动终端所具备的功能种类和性能要求越来越高,如通信功能、上网功能、音频功能和拍照功能等都已经成为智能终端或移动终端的必备功能。
现有的移动终端中,用户由于为了节省电量以及清理内存,常会直接将应用程序的后台进程关闭,当用户需要使用应用程序时,需要重新启动应用程序的进程。而对于一些在启动进程的时候,需要在其他应用程序中查询相应信息的应用程序来讲,如短信应用和通话记录应用等通信应用,当启动通信应用程序的进程的时候,需要启动一个线程去查询每个通信会话以及其相关信息,并进行缓存,而每查询一个通信会话,就需要切换到联系人应用的进程去查询与通信会话的通信号码对应的联系人的信息,这样就需要在不同的应用进程中进行切换,尤其是查询的次数或者数据过多,需要反复切换,增加终端的后台工作负担,容易导致移动终端响应慢、卡顿及白屏问题。
发明内容
本发明实施例提供一种通信应用的启动方法及移动终端,以解决现有的通信应用在进程启动的时候,需要在不同应用程序间反复切换,导致后台工作负担加大,容易出现响应慢、卡顿及白屏的问题。
一方面,本发明实施例提供了一种通信应用的启动方法,所述通信应用中包括多个通信会话,所述方法应用于移动终端,所述方法包括:
启动通信应用的进程;
从联系人应用中获取与每个通信会话的通信号码对应的联系人信息;
将获取的多个联系人信息缓存至所述通信应用中;
在缓存至所述通信应用中的多个联系人信息中,查询与每个通信会话的通信号码对应的联系人信息;
在每个通信会话中显示所述对应的联系人信息。
另一方面,本发明实施例还提供一种移动终端,所述移动终端包括通信应用,所述通信应用中包括多个通信会话,所述移动终端还包括:
启动模块,用于启动通信应用的进程;
获取模块,用于从联系人应用中获取与每个通信会话的通信号码对应的联系人信息;
缓存模块,用于将获取的多个联系人信息缓存至所述通信应用中;
第一查询模块,用于在缓存至所述通信应用中的多个联系人信息中,查询与每个通信会话的通信号码对应的联系人信息;
第一显示模块,用于在每个通信会话中显示所述对应的联系人信息。
又一方面,本发明实施例还提供一种移动终端,所述移动终端包括处理器、存储器及存储在所述存储器上并可在所述处理器上运行的通信应用,所述通信应用中包括多个通信会话,所述通信应用的启动方法被所述处理器执行时实现如权利要求1至5中任一项所述的通信应用的启动方法的步骤。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于维沃移动通信有限公司,未经维沃移动通信有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710377895.4/2.html,转载请声明来源钻瓜专利网。